Joe Cocker-Joe Cocker Live (1990)

In 1990, Joe Cocker was at the height of his popularity, having released a dozen high-energy albums that captured his raw and passionate rock and soul style. That year saw the release of the double live album "Joe Cocker Live", undoubtedly a masterful sonic document of his concerts during those years, brimming with intensity and contained energy. Accompanied by an excellent backing band featuring Chris Station, Steve Holley, Jeff Levine, Phil Grande, and The Memphis Horn, Cocker delivers one of the most memorable live performances with his raspy voice, intense stage presence, and deeply emotional songs. Recorded at the Memorial Auditorium in Massachusetts in October 1989, this is an excellent retrospective of some of his musical highlights. From the passionate “Unchain My Heart” to the powerful “With a Little Help From My Friends” and the emotive “You Are So Beautiful”, and including the energetic rock tracks “Feelin’ Alright”, “You Can Leave Your Hat On”, “The Letter”, and “High Time We Went”, “Joe Cocker Live” is a retrospective album that undoubtedly cements the status of one of the greatest and most authentic performers that rock and soul have ever known.
